c语言面试题库 pdf

时间: 2023-05-13 07:02:30 浏览: 100
C语言是一种广泛使用的计算机编程语言,它能够胜任多种计算机应用程序的开发,它也是许多企业面试时的重要考察内容。很多求职者在准备C语言面试时,都需要寻找一些资料进行学习和练习。 其中,C语言面试题库PDF是一种很常见的准备材料。这种面试题库一般包括了多个章节和主题,针对不同方面的C语言知识点,提供了大量的面试题目和答案进行学习和练习。通过这样的面试题库,求职者能更加深入的了解C语言的各种知识点、概念和应用,提高自己的面试水平。 C语言面试题库PDF提供了很多典型的面试问题,如指针、函数、数组、结构体、文件操作等,这些问题挑选了不同难度等级,从而适合不同水平的求职者。通过这些问题的练习,求职者可以逐渐提升自己的技能,增强自信心和面试状态。 但需要注意的是,C语言面试题库PDF只是一种辅助学习的资料,而不是万能的,除了学习它,求职者还应该多参加实际项目的开发和实践,以此来提高自己的技能水平和经验。另外,准备C语言面试的时候,还应该考虑自己的表达能力、沟通能力和思考能力等,以此来全面提升自己的面试水平。
相关问题

嵌入式开发c语言面试题c语言面试题 pdf

嵌入式开发是指在嵌入式系统中进行软件开发的过程,而C语言则是嵌入式开发中常用的编程语言之一。对于嵌入式开发领域的从业者来说,熟练掌握C语言是必不可少的。以下是一些常见的C语言面试题: 1. 请解释一下C语言中的指针和引用的概念,并举例说明它们的用法。 2. 请解释一下C语言中的内存管理机制,包括动态内存分配和释放。 3. 请编写一个简单的C语言函数,实现对一个整数数组的排序。 4. 请解释一下C语言中的结构体(struct)和联合体(union)的概念和用法。 5. 请解释一下C语言中的宏定义和预处理器指令的用法,并举例说明。 这些问题涉及到C语言的基础知识和常用的编程技巧,是面试中常常会遇到的。通过对这些问题的认真回答,可以展示出求职者对C语言的熟练程度和实际应用能力。 以上是C语言面试题的部分内容,对于希望在嵌入式开发领域就业的求职者来说,通过认真准备和练习,能够更好地展现自己的技能和知识水平,为自己赢得更多的机会。希望这些面试题对大家有所帮助。

c语言基础题库csdn

CSDN上的C语言基础题库涵盖了C语言的基本知识点和常见题型,是学习C语言的学生和初学者的良好资源。在这个题库中,可以找到关于变量、数据类型、运算符、控制语句、函数、数组、指针等各种方面的题目。 这些题目涵盖了从简单到复杂的各种类型,适合不同阶段的学习者进行练习。从入门级的基础题到进阶的高级题,都可以在这个题库中找到,为学习者提供了系统的练习和测试平台。在解题过程中,学习者可以了解和熟悉C语言的语法规则、特性和应用技巧,提高编程能力和解决问题的能力。 此外,CSDN上的C语言基础题库还提供了题目的详细解析和参考答案,学习者可以通过学习其他人的解题思路和方法,丰富自己的编程思维和经验,加深对C语言的理解和掌握。 总的来说,CSDN上的C语言基础题库对于学习C语言的人来说是一个不错的选择,可以帮助他们系统地学习和理解C语言的基础知识,提高编程水平,为今后的学习和工作打下坚实的基础。

相关推荐

最新推荐

大学C语言考试题库(含答案).docx

C语言大学教材 免费下载 大家共同学习 以后会分享更多资源 C语言是一门面向过程的、抽象化的通用程序设计语言,广泛应用于底层开发。C语言能以简易的方式编译、处理低级存储器。C语言是仅产生少量的机器语言以及不...

C语言基础(全).pdf

包含的内容都是博客的,这里只是整理成了PDF方便查看,下载前请先浏览博客查看是否需要。(后续有时间的话会优化内容)

C语言基础面试题02(指针和内存).docx

本文档主要是针对C语言的内存和指针部分的基础面试题,我们可以把内存想象为成一列很长很长的货运火车,有很多大小相同的车厢,而每个车厢正好相当于在内存中表示一个字节。这些车厢装着不同的货物,就像我们的内存...

C语言程序设计+研究生复试+求职+面试题

可供研究生复试或相关专业岗位面试使用。如: 简述C语⾔采取了哪些措施提⾼执⾏效率; ⼆维数组在物理上以及逻辑上的数组维度理解; 隐式类型转换的四种情况; 结构体对⻬规则; 指针在函数中的应用和特点; C 语言...

面试中常见的C语言问题

第一节 C语言编程中的几个基本概念 1.1 #include与#include" " 1. #include和#include" "有什么区别? 这个题目考查大家的基础能力,#include用来包含开发环境提供的库, #include" "用来包含.c/.cpp文件...

GIS设备运行管理重点及运行注意事项PPT课件.pptx

GIS设备运行管理重点及运行注意事项PPT课件.pptx

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ire

电子商务中的多渠道销售管理技术

# 1. 多渠道销售管理技术的概述 1.1 电子商务中的多渠道销售概念及特点 在当今数字化时代,多渠道销售已成为企业成功的关键。多渠道销售是指企业通过多种不同的销售渠道(如线下实体店铺、线上电子商务平台、移动应用等)向消费者提供产品或服务的销售模式。这种模式的特点包括覆盖面广、销售渠道多样化、服务体验多样化等。 1.2 多渠道销售管理技术的重要性 多渠道销售管理技术的引入可以有效帮助企业实现跨渠道销售数据的整合与分析,提高销售效率,优化用户体验,增强市场竞争力。通过技术手段的支持,企业可以更好地监控和管理不同销售渠道的表现,及时作出调整和改进。 1.3 多渠道销售管理技术对商业发展的影响

cuda 的库目录环境变量, 在cmake中

在 CMake 中,可以使用 `find_library()` 函数来查找 CUDA 库文件并将其链接到目标中。此函数会自动查找 CUDA 库文件所在的目录,并将该目录添加到目标的链接器路径中。如果需要指定 CUDA 库文件的目录,可以在 `find_library()` 函数中设置 `PATHS` 参数。例如,以下代码段可以在 CMake 中查找 CUDA 库文件并将其链接到目标中: ``` find_library(CUDA_LIBS cudart PATHS /path/to/cuda/lib) target_link_libraries(my_target ${CUDA_LIBS}

知识产权大数据平台建设方案.docx

知识产权大数据平台建设方案.docx